Sweden’s defense advisor Jan Eldeblad is urging New Zealand to create a psychological defense agency, modeled after Sweden’s 2022 launch, to combat rising “grey zone” operations and disinformation from hostile states. Drawing lessons from Ukraine, Eldeblad champions rapid, adaptive decision-making and a “total defense” strategy blending military and civilian efforts. He highlights how even Swedish units are pushing for faster command structures, proving change is possible with strong backing. Meanwhile, former officer Graeme Doull proposes an agile, commercial-speed tech acquisition body to bridge the gap between hardware and expertise, while Dr. Del Carlini calls for a complete naval overhaul centered on maritime drones—emphasizing agility over tradition in modern warfare.
